The Oceanside Track and Field Club held their awards night at Ballenas

Secondary School on March 12, to hand out the hardware to those who had an excellent 2013 season.

• Outstanding newcomer: Kokeb Cooper, Felix Richter

• Most improved: Allie Proctor, Kyra Blyt, Noah Elliott, Simon Morrison

• Outstanding sportsmanship: Libby Elliott, Kate Morrison, Alena Woolnough, Colson Schneider

• Outstanding effort: Nathaniel Abel, Logan Keltie, Rebecca Bassett, Peter Oxland

• Most inspirational: Serena Woolnough, Steven Schan

• Outstanding performance: Taylor Sayah, Steven Schan, Peter Oxland, Miryam Bassett, Makayla Hoey, Felix Richter, Thomas Oxland

• Outstanding female: Miryam Bassett, Makayla Hoey

• Outstanding male: Thomas Oxland, Felix Richter
